    I had the turkey leg, broccoli casserole, cabbage, cornbread and a slice of strawberry cake. The plates come with a meat & 3 sides or you can substitute out a side for a dessert or drink. The turkey leg was baked and seasoned well. The temperature of the food was spot on. You didn't have to wait to eat it. (Except for the cornbread. It was cold and dry)
    Not sure how long they've been in this building, but it's time to either expand or find a larger location. The parking spots are tight and it doesn't seem many people dine in with them.
    I'll probably try the fried chicken (my wife said it was good) next time. Adding beans to the menu could work too (Lima, butter or black eyed peas)

    Was recommended by friend to check it out.  Had the fried fish, cabbage, Mac n cheese, meatloaf, green beans, you know the basics.  Really just comfort food plain and simple.  Price was more than fair and everyone was very friendly.  Even at 2:30 there was a steady flow of folks in and out, probably 50/50 for people taking food to go and those eating in.   Only wish I had been able to try the peach cobbler. Must be good if they ran out of it!  Give Grandmas a try you won't be disappointed.  Peace.
